I feel like a good website is self explanatory and can be navigable without training or assistance. One example that comes to mind is the obvious Facebook. One of the common jokes I hear in regards to Facebook’s design is that in the first week everyone complains when the layout is altered yet no one remembers anything the week after. To me, this is a testimony of a good layout that is easy to adapt to and can be altered when necessary.

The problem with designs is that if they are made too simplistic, the design can be considered ugly and made for children. If the design is too complicated, no on will be able to understand it. The best websites are the most used and are usually shopping websites like Amazon. In fact, I must assume that most shopping websites all have common themes like gender, age, and clothing type divisions along with search ability, store locations, and return policies. With this situation I do not think all of these websites agreed to these categories in a large meeting but I think that happenstance and previous consumer responses have led many companies to adopt the same standards. For this reason feedback is important to designing the ideal website and this same feedback can lead to many similar website designs. That also makes me wonder about copyright.
